Brian Andrew Miller, 71, of Methuen, MA, passed away on November 15, 2021, at Lawrence General Hospital. Born on January 22, 1950, he was the son of the late Harold and Rose (Narushef) Miller.
A kind and thoughtful man, Brian enjoyed helping others even though he had limited abilities. He always checked in with his life-long friend and neighbor, Mrs. Swan, and would bring her mail in to her and watch Mass. He also visited his friend Neil and his mom with whom he was very fond. Brian enjoyed playing the guitar and listening to classic rock music. You could find him watching the Three Stooges marathons, cartoons, Patriots and Red Sox games.
Brian found freedom from his disabilities while riding his lawn mower and cutting grass. He often mowed his lawn, and would also take care of his neighbor’s lawns from time to time. His daily destination was the Howe Street Superette, where he would strike up a conversation with anyone and everyone. He considered every person he met a friend. He enjoyed buying scratch tickets and tried his luck, but never hit the jackpot.
Several years ago on a December morning, Brian was struck while walking and suffered serious injuries, this incident brought him Tom, a very important person in his life. He returned home after months in Boston hospitals and rehabilitation centers, and was finally able to walk to his beloved store and share his story. Brian was a local celebrity, he made the most of everyday and never got saddened about what life gave him. Even with all of the shortcomings and struggles he endured, he will be remembered by many as a fixture on Howe Street who cannot be replaced.
